New law makes it easier to get medical marijuana in Virginia

Eligible patients looking to purchase medical marijuana in Virginia no longer have to wait for the all-clear from the state pharmacy board.

The new law went into effect Friday, and said after receiving written certification from a registered practitioner, patients can go directly to a medical marijuana dispensary.

That means a medical marijuana card is no longer necessary. The new requirement also applies to legal guardians and parents of minors.

It’s a move that will address the state’s backlog, which has left many frustrated. Before July 1, thousands of patients were waiting for board approval.

There are currently more than 50,000 patients registered in the state.

Gov. Glenn Youngkin signed HB 933 and SB 671 earlier this year, making the process easier for patients. The change will also cut out the $50 medical license fee that was previously required.

Trump announces a $22.5B makeover of Dulles airport that will eliminate the ‘people movers’

WASHINGTON (AP) — President Donald Trump on Wednesday announced a $22.5 billion renovation of Washington Dulles International Airport that will end the use of the widely disliked “people movers,” the mobile lounges that have been used for decades to shuttle travelers to and from the main terminal. In place of the people movers, the airport will add a new U-shaped passenger train, a central walking tunnel, more moving walkways and new concourses. An above-ground parking garage closer to the main terminal with space for 32,000 vehicles is also in the offing, according to Trump and Transportation Secretary Sean Duffy. The airport makeover would add to a long list of renovation projects the Republican president is pursuing to leave a lasting mark on the Washington region after his term ends in January 2029. Among other undertakings, he is building a new White House ballroom and wants to build a towering triumphal arch near the Lincoln Memorial. But of all the construction projects Trump is pursuing, the renovations at Dulles could prove to be his most popular and benefit the greatest number of people. The airport, the area’s primary international airport, served roughly 29 million passengers over the past year, according to the Metropolitan Washington Airports Authority.
